TRAFFIC ACCIDENT: Driver in van rollover near Larimore identified, citations unlikely

No charges are likely following a van rollover Sunday that injured 10 people, a North Dakota Highway Patrol spokesman said.

The van was carrying 12 people when it rolled in the ditch near Larimore, N.D..

Paul K. Maendel, 17, Fordville, N.D., was driving the van about 12:30 p.m. Sunday, according to Capt. Kevin Robson, with the state Highway Patrol in Grand Forks.

According to Robson, Maendel lost control of the van on state Highway 18, one mile north of Larimore. The roads were slushy and wet, according to Robson.

Maendel was not injured. Six passengers were treated at the scene for minor injuries and four were transported to Altru Hospital with minor injuries, Robson said.
